自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(97)
  • 收藏
  • 关注

DOM简介

DOM简介DOM编程就是讲怎么使用JavaScript操作界面上一大堆控件。JavaScript和DOM的关系就相当于,C#和.NET Framework之间的关系。想想看,如果只是学习C#语言本身你能干什么事情吗?C#语言使什么东西?For循环、While语句、If语句、定义一个类,两个类之间继承。如果只掌握这些,你能够写出有意义的程序吗?你只能对一个数组进行一个For循环,这个数组是C#本...

2011-08-31 21:25:00 62

Android: 保存文件系统节点

保存文件系统所有节点,以备查询之需,尤其找一写driver节点的时候比较方便:cd /find > /mnt/sdcard/sysfs.txt..../sys/devices/platform/amcanvas/55./sys/devices/platform/amcanvas/55/addr./sys/devices/platform/amcanvas/55/wid...

2011-08-31 10:20:00 89

Android自动化测试工具——Monkey

前言:最近开始研究Android自动化测试方法,整理了一些工具、方法和框架,其中包括android测试框架,CTS、Monkey、Monkeyrunner、benchmark,以及其它test tool等等。一、 什么是MonkeyMonkey是Android中的一个命令行工具,可以运行在模拟器里或实际设备中。它向系统发送伪随机的用户事件流(如按键输入、触摸屏输...

2011-08-31 09:45:00 67

基础的qmail安装说明文档

安装qmail说明文档 制作者:赵艳静 2011-8-26目录系统类型... 1准备安装环境... 1基本环境... 1检查系统组件... 1准备软件包... 1检查编译环境... 2停用sendmail(或postfix)... 2 创建qmail账户... 2创建qmail相关目录... 3目录结构... 3创建目录... 3安装qm...

2011-08-30 16:43:00 664

Php的安装以及验证apache

Php的安装以及验证apachePhp安装tar jxf php-5.3.8.tar.bz2cd php-5.3.8./configure --with-apxs2=/usr/local/apache2/bin/apxs--with-mysqlmakemake install编译php报错情况php-5.3.8]# ./configure--with-apx...

2011-08-30 16:39:00 547

Android: Launch the HOME screen

ACTION_MAINwith categoryCATEGORY_HOME-- Launch the home screen. Intent intent = new Intent(Intent.ACTION_MAIN); intent.addFlags(Intent.FLAG_ACTIVITY_NEW_TASK); intent.addCategory(...

2011-08-30 12:38:00 83

WCF一步一步往前爬(五)

第五步:WCF安全机制---续。传输通道级别保护一个HTTP服务1、在ProductsServiceHost项目app.config右键“编辑WCF配置”,新建一个绑定配置,类型为basicHttpBinding,名称ProductsServiceBasicHttpBindingConfig,Mode:Transport。将终结点BasicHttpBinding_IProducts...

2011-08-29 22:29:00 78

WP7编程 XNA框架中播放动画

以源码的形式介绍XNA框架中如何播放动画序列测试环境:VS2010SP1+WP7.1开发工具需要的图片,或,代码中有不明白的地方,请参考下面的网址http://www.cnblogs.com/TerryBlog/archive/2011/03/23/1992912.html下面是我的源码,是根据上面网址中的内容自己归纳为一个C#源文件,方便以后自己查询using System;...

2011-08-29 21:56:00 66

Android如何防止apk程序被反编译

作为Android应用开发者,不得不面对一个尴尬的局面,就是自己辛辛苦苦开发的应用可以被别人很轻易的就反编译出来。Google似乎也发现了这个问题,从SDK2.3开始我们可以看到在android-sdk-windows\tools\下面多了一个proguard文件夹proguard是一个java代码混淆的工具,通过proguard,别人即使反编译你的apk包,也只会看到一些...

2011-08-28 23:07:00 265

Android APK反编译详解(附图)

这段时间在学Android应用开发,在想既然是用Java开发的应该很好反编译从而得到源代码吧,google了一下,确实很简单,以下是我的实践过程。在此郑重声明,贴出来的目的不是为了去破解人家的软件,完全是一种学习的态度,不过好像通过这种方式也可以去汉化一些外国软件。一、反编译Apk得到Java源代码首先要下载两个工具:dex2jar和JD-GUI前者是将apk中的class...

2011-08-28 22:42:00 1289 1

如何排除 Windows Communication Foundation (WCF) 安装问题

有些 Windows Communication Foundation 注册表项无法通过在 .NET Framework 3.0 上执行 MSI 修复操作来修复如果您删除下面的任何注册表项:H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\ServiceModelService 3.0.0.0HKEY_LOCAL_MACHI...

2011-08-28 21:35:00 522

WCF一步一步往前爬(四)

第四步:WCF安全问题探讨。以及如何使用“服务跟踪查询器”工具。WCF程序有更多的安全问题,因为消息需要跨越机器边界传递,对消息进行加密是一方面,带签名是另一种方式。通常WCF包括传输通道和消息级别的安全性。如https就是具有更高安全性的传输专用通道,消息级别包括加密和解密等。一、消息级别的TCP服务保护示例:NetTcpBinding绑定的消息加密。宿主程序和客户端的配置文件中...

2011-08-27 22:12:00 60

Android: softkey WAKE and WAKE_DPOPPED

WAKE: When this key is pressed while the device is asleep, the device will wake up and the key event gets sent to the app.WAKE_DROPPED: When this key is pressed while the device is asleep, the de...

2011-08-27 18:35:00 85

有关于24小时营业

上篇提到早上五点多的时候去到一家24小时营业的药店买药的事情。去到那药店门口的时候,大门却紧闭,却在大门玻璃开着一个小窗口,贴着告示说买药请按门铃,里面灯光还在。于是按门铃,很快服务员走出来了,通过小窗口完成了买药的过程。不禁为这种营业方式拍手叫好。既不用专人整晚在守候着顾客的到来,又打响了一块招牌。服务员可以在里面睡觉,休息都可以,有顾客来提供服务就行了,同时只需开着灯,就提高了药店...

2011-08-27 06:59:00 66

寻找帮助的途径

昨晚女友要去应酬,喝酒到凌晨才回来。早上五点多的时候被她吵醒了,说喝酒皮肤过敏睡不着,要我去买药,于是我急忙忙赶下去了。去到附近的两家连锁药店,却都大门紧闭,无奈之余,只能买些啤酒回去,尝试涂在她身上或者能减轻痒感。找到附近的乐佳便利店,幸好是24小时营业的,拿了啤酒后,问那小MM有没有过敏药卖,回答当然是没有。后来找钱的时候她却告诉我,前面红绿灯有家24小时药店。大喜过望,连忙赶...

2011-08-27 06:45:00 124

android LinearLayout和RelativeLayout实现精确布局

先明确几个概念的区别:padding margin:都是边距的含义,关键问题得明白是什么相对什么的边距padding:是控件的内容相对控件的边缘的边距.margin :是控件边缘相对父空间的边距android:gravity是对该view 内容的限定.比如一个button 上面的text. 你可以设置该text 在view的靠左,靠右等位置.该属性就干了这个.and...

2011-08-26 21:42:00 125

WCF一步一步往前爬(三)

第三步:在客户端捕获WCF服务异常。如果是Debug过程,简单的方法就是在宿主项目ProductsServiceHost中的app.config文件中,设置<serviceDebug includeExceptionDetailInFaults="true"/>,或则直接在service的实现类上添加ServiceBehavior特性,如下[ServiceBehavio...

2011-08-26 21:03:00 98

WCF一步一步往前爬(二)

第二步:WCF宿主程序用哪种类型比较好? 主要的托管宿主包括,IIS,控制台程序,WPF,Windows Forms,NT Service,Windows服务,COM+作为宿主。IIS部署简单,可以向发布Web Service一样部署,但是仅仅支持HTML协议,而且宿主进程在客户请求时候启动。控制台作为宿主托管简单,一般做简单WCF 编程时候使用。Windows Forms宿主可以提供管理宿主...

2011-08-25 21:11:00 111

江山代有人才出,各领风骚两三年。感叹多鼠标软件MultiMouse的诞生。

我以前写过《Windows下多鼠标/双鼠标技术专题》系列文章,其实说明了,那是我在湖南大学毕业时候写的毕业论文,今天需要给这个论文加个新的注脚了。一个大学生用多鼠标技术做出了一个系统级可用的多鼠标软件。非常感叹~~~我老了~~~大家围观吧:http://www.duote.com/soft/42098.html【基本介绍】 运行本程序,连接多个鼠标,可以获得实际鼠标...

2011-08-25 12:25:00 132

WCF一步一步往前爬(一)

第一步:我们将建议WCF服务,和一个客户端。最后把它发布到IIS上。在开始建WCF服务之前,需要一个NBuilder.dll。我们有了它可以免去建数据库的麻烦。1、新建一个解决方案,右键添加新建网站,选择WCF服务,地址自己确定。2、将NBuilder引入到项目,在App_Code下新建两个数据表类tblProduct.cs,tblProductInventory.csusingS...

2011-08-24 21:22:00 119

cocos2d-x开发游戏时,使用Texture packer来合并图片

write by 九天雁翎(JTianLing) -- www.jtianling.comTexture packer的确比Zwoptex更加强大,功能更多,跨平台,在使用cocos2d-x在win32下开发的时候,能够在win32下使用的优点就更加明显了。何况Zwoptex以前是完全免费的,在用户多了以后坑爹般的开始收费了,连个可用的免费版本都没有(只有自己保留的老版本可用)...

2011-08-24 16:18:00 249

有关于RTX本地缓存的问题

最近对外发布了一个游戏更新包,因为是大版本,有问题在所难免。于是,很快就要打一个紧急补丁包出去。这是之前我开发的一个工具,只对要修改的文件处理,高效快捷。只需更新一个文件,于是叫相关同事在内部RTX上发过来, 接着,更新包打好测试后便对外发布。 没想到,更新包出现问题了,一些理论上没问题的功能出现异常。 于是便紧急查打入更新包的那个文件,发现不是最新的,但修改文件那同事确认发过来...

2011-08-24 09:01:00 231

OutLook设置

很久没更新博客了这段日子一直在忙着找工作面试啊,经历坎坷,现在可算是稳定下了,又开始写我的博客了新的工作貌似比较轻松,以前的工作都是跟运维相关的,现在要接触一点测试,刚开始还真是有点不太适应不过还得死马当活马医,呵呵呵,上吧初来乍到,先分享一下之前没用过的outlook的设置情况以前都是使用云邮,现在要使用outlook还真不知道怎么着手以前用linux和freeBSD习惯...

2011-08-23 22:25:00 137

Android --- 图片的特效处理

Android --- 图片处理的方法转换 - drawable To bitmap缩放 - Zoom圆角 - Round Corner倒影 - ReflectedbitmapPrcess code:package com.learn.games;import android.graphics.Bitmap;import android.graphics.Ca...

2011-08-23 22:25:00 263

Android之多线程工作-AsyncTask与handler

本文章主要讲解下AsyncTask的使用以及Hnadler的应用。首先,我们得明确下一个概念,什么是UI线程。顾名思义,ui线程就是管理着用户界面的那个线程!android的ui线程操作并不是安全的,并且和用户直接进行界面交互的操作都必须在ui线程中进行才可以。这种模式叫做单线程模式。我们在单线程模式下编程一定要注意:不要阻塞ui线程、确保只在ui线程中访问ui组件。...

2011-08-23 20:40:00 97

android字体闪烁动画(线程)

android字体闪烁动画,使用线程和Timer实现public class ActivityMain extends Activity { public void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.main); spa...

2011-08-23 20:02:00 134

wordpress安装及配置

用一个周末总算在ubuntu下把www.jtianling.com博客搭建好了,这里分享一些不成熟的经验。准备工作安装wordpress前需要安装的软件如下:1.apache2,这个不用说了,没有apache就没有http服务器啊。apt-get install apache22.php5,wordpress是用php写的apt-get install libapach...

2011-08-23 10:15:00 667

Asp.net MVC学习日记十七(页面Cache)

1、Models/Product.cspublic class Product { public Guid ProductID { get; set; } public string Name { get; set; } public decimal Discount { get; set; } public decimal Retail { get; set; } p...

2011-08-22 21:00:00 53

Asp.net MVC学习日记十六(数据Cache)

1、新建Models/Product.cs public class Product { public string Name { get; set; } public decimal Price { get; set; } }2、新建Models/ProductService.cs public class ProductService { public Li...

2011-08-22 20:50:00 61

Asp.net MVC学习日记十五(保持用户登录)

1、新建Account,AccountService,SessionWrapperpublic class Account { public Guid AccountId { get; set; } public string Username { get; set; } public string Email { get; set; } public List<st...

2011-08-22 14:46:00 195

IoC(控制反转)与依赖注入是什么个概念

IOC是Inversion of Control的缩写,多数书籍翻译成“控制反转”,还有些书籍翻译成为“控制反向”或者“控制倒置”。 1996年,Michael Mattson在一篇有关探讨面向对象框架的文章中,首先提出了IOC 这个概念。对于面向对象设计及编程的基本思想,前面我们已经讲了很多了,不再赘述,简单来说就是把复杂系统分解成相互合作的对象,这些对象类通过封装以后,内部实现对外部是...

2011-08-22 11:01:00 159

Asp.net MVC学习日记十四(页面提交验证)

首先看看mvc自己是怎么做的1、新建Person类public class Person { [DisplayName("First Name"), StringLength(10)] public string FirstName { get; set; } [DisplayName("Middle Name"), StringLength(50)] public s...

2011-08-21 21:06:00 76

Asp.net MVC学习日记十三(页面导航)

准备工作去http://mvcsitemap.codeplex.com/下载MvcSiteMapProvider.dll1、把MvcSiteMapProvider.dll加入工程引用2、在Web.config中system.web节点内<siteMap defaultProvider="MvcSiteMapProvider" enabled="true"> <pr...

2011-08-21 20:07:00 75

Asp.net MVC学习日记十二(强大的MvcContrib,自动生成html元素)

1、http://mvccontrib.codeplex.com/下载MvcContrib,http://blog.jqueryui.com/2010/09/jquery-ui-1-8-5/下载jquery-ui.js。(留意版本的问题) 当然NBuilder.dll也是必须的(如果你不知道这是什么,看看前面的,或者google下,呵呵)2、把MvcContrib中的InputBuilde...

2011-08-21 17:42:00 134

Csharp 语句纵览

Csharp 语句纵览本篇主要讲解C#中的语句,主要包括基本语句、跳转语句、迭代语句和选择语句还有其他语句如continue、break等。1、 基本语句空语句(empty statement)不包括任何实际性语句,它什么都不做。标记语句(labeled statement)可以给语句加上一个标签作为前缀,它可以出现在块中,但是不允许它们作为嵌入语句。表达式语句是C#语言程序代...

2011-08-20 07:51:00 602

Asp.net MVC学习日记十一(JQuery异步提交表单)

1、去http://jquery.malsup.com/form/.下载 jquery.form.js插件2、引入jquery-1.6.2.min.js和jquery.form.js <script src="../../Scripts/jquery-1.6.2.min.js" type="text/javascript"></script> <scrip...

2011-08-19 16:42:00 124

Android播放器为何暂停后继续播放却没有继续?

问题:最近在做音乐播放器这个模块,发现一个问题,在点击暂停按钮后,歌曲是暂停了,但是再一次点击播放按钮后,歌曲并没有继续播放,而是重新播放了。分析:如果真的是按照网上的例子做好判断并且API调用没有问题的话,那么下面这个就有99%的可能性了,那就是,你的播放器对象创建了多次。也就是说,我重新点击播放的时候,您老又创建了一个MediaPlayer实例。这当然不会继续播放啦。解决办法:...

2011-08-19 11:31:00 503

Asp.net MVC学习日记十(JQuery删除)

1、Product和ProductRepository是必须的public class Product { public int ProductId { get; set; } public string Name { get; set; } public double Price { get; set; } public string Description { get;...

2011-08-19 09:52:00 110

Asp.net MVC学习日记九(JQuer利用模式弹出详细)

准备工作:http://nyromodal.googlecode.com/files/nyroModal-1.6.2.zip,在这个地址下载JQuery插件1、将jquery.nyroModal-1.6.2.min.js和Content/nyroModal.full.css导入 <script src="../../Scripts/jquery-1.6.2.min.js" typ...

2011-08-18 22:45:00 94

Asp.net MVC学习日记八(JQuery和分部视图,查看详细)

1、新建类Product和ProductRepository public class Product { public int ProductId { get; set; } public string Name { get; set; } public double Price { get; set; } public string Description { get;...

2011-08-18 21:43:00 166

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除